We’ve heard from quite a few of you that saw a listing with a great price, only discover that it has a bad CarFax. womp womp. While we still cannot definitively determine the title status of the 2.7 million active used listings in our catalog yet, we can search within the listing notes for keywords like “salvage,” “branded,” “hail damage,” etc to exclude obvious lemons. We can also use keyword search to look for “one owner” and “clean title!” We have a lot of other keywords in mind to come 🔜

When shopping for used cars, there are certain things you may want to see right up front: the mileage (obviously), CarFax, and warranty status. Starting today, for some used vehicles, you’ll be able to glance the original manufacturer warranty status near the top of the listing to determine if it’s fully active, partially active, expiring, or fully expired. We’re working on expanding this feature to all vehicles, so bear with us!
Before, the pricing information on listings was a bit scattered. We wanted to improve the flow of the listing page and make sure all pricing information was clearly laid out.
In addition to the pricing history you’re used to seeing, you’ll now see a tab called “Leaderboard” for used or certified listings. This is where we want to benchmark the listing you’re looking at against similar vehicles with about the same mileage. In the top right, you can select the parameters you want to compare against to other listings. In the table, you can see how this listing stacks up against others. We hope this helps with negotiations and general gut-checking of the market. Stay tuned for something like this, but for new vehicles.
